Northumberland Homes Evacuated After 'Suspicious Items' Found During Arrest

Police describe the incident as isolated with precautionary measures in place.

Overview

  • Officers conducting a routine arrest on Welbeck Road in Guide Post early Wednesday, just before 4:30 a.m., found a quantity of suspicious items inside a home.
  • Police set up a cordon around the residential street and evacuated several nearby houses as a safety step, leaving some residents out in the early morning.
  • Specialist teams are due to attend to examine the items, and officers remain on scene to manage the area.
  • Northumbria Police say the incident is not linked to any other case, and they have not disclosed what the items are.
  • Northumberland Fire and Rescue sent three engines to assist, and anyone with concerns has been asked to approach an officer on duty.
